Effect of organic and inorganic fertilizers on vegetative growth, and reproductive growth parameters of sapota (Manilkara achras Forsberg) Var. Kalipatti


Author(s): AM Bhosale, SM Harimohan and SJ Syed

Abstract: The present investigation was conducted at Department of Horticulture, Vasantrao Naik Marathwada Agriculture University, Parbhani during the year 2009-10. The experiment was laid out in randomized block design with three replication and ten treatments. In this investigation the sapota tree were applied with different organic and inorganic fertilizers and their combination namely T1 (100% RDF), T7 (100% FYM), T3 (100% Vermicompost), T4 (50% FYM + 50% Vermicompost), T5 (75%RDF+ 25% FYM), T6 (50% RDF + 50% FYM), T7 (25% RDF + 75% FYM), T8 (75% RDF + 25% Vermicompost), T9 (50% RDF + 50% Vermicompost) and T10 (25% RDF + 75% Vermicompost). The effects of these treatments were noted on vegetative growth, reproductive growth, and yield attributes of sapota. The results of experimentation on confirmed the efficiency of integration of organic and chemical fertilizers for better growth, and yield of sapota. The application of 50% RDF + 50% Vermicompost enhanced the vegetative and reproductive growth as well as yield attributes.
